OnePlus Watch Design
Rumours say the OnePlus Watch looks similar to the Samsung Galaxy Active 2 (without the touch dial). It has a rubber band, and colour variants include silver and black.
The watch has a 1.39-inch AMOLED display and HD 454 x 454 with 326ppi pixel density. Recently leaked images show two buttons on the right edge of the case. One power button and one function button. A microphone and speaker are also seen, so we can assume the device will be able to make and receive calls.
Features
Basic fitness and health tracking will be available on the watch. This includes automatic workout detection, blood oxygen, heart rate, and sleep monitoring. However, it is unlikely to be suitable for swimming with 5atm water resistance and IP68 dust resistance.
Inside the OnePlus Watch
Unsurprisingly, the device is Android compatible. However, there is a rumour that an iOs compatible version may be available later.
When it comes to battery life, the OnePlus Watch makes an impressive claim. You can expect up to 1 week of use, including 25 hours of continuous exercise and GPS from just 20 minutes of charge.
Release date and price
As we have already mentioned, it’s likely the watch will make an appearance today. We are expecting it to fall into the mid-point price range for smartwatches at around $178.
Limited Edition
Rumours also talk about a limited-edition OnePlus Watch Cobalt variant. The design is slightly different, offering sapphire glass, flat-screen and vegan leather strap.
